We are the knit. Sunday, January 13, 2008. It is not that I've not been knitting, it's that I've been too lazy to bother posting anything.so here we are:. This is a diagonal rib stitch scarf, which looks a lot more exciting than it probably is. Here's the stitch detail:. CO a multiple of 4 stitches (this is 32). Row 1: *k2, p2; rep from *. Row 2: Rep Row 1. Row 3: k1, *p2, k2; rep from *, end p2, k1. Row 4: p1, *k2, p2; rep from *, end k2, p1. Row 5: *p2, k2; rep from *. Row 6: Rep Row 5. Row 7: Rep Row 4.
